Output 3868ea3d63f8db66280c2cba92821ac582d6fd17ae869c7da3818383854b6af4:1

value
126272314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c887cabb3b9c56225ec40b77a1ab15d438a4345 OP_EQUAL
address
3A8HbUVXuMazveTZizaLhRCNAQhTbhyoEg
transaction
3868ea3d63f8db66280c2cba92821ac582d6fd17ae869c7da3818383854b6af4